Cookies

When you leave a comment on our site, you can indicate whether your name, your e-mail address and site may be stored in a cookie. For your convenience, we do this so that you do not have to re-enter this information for a new response. These cookies are valid for one year.

If you visit our login page, we store a temporary cookie to check whether your browser accepts cookies. This cookie does not contain any personal data and is deleted as soon as you close your browser.

Once you log in, we will store some cookies in connection with your login information and screen display options. Login cookies are valid for 2 days and cookies for screen display options 1 year. If you select “Remind me”, your login will be saved for 2 weeks. As soon as you log out of your account, login cookies are deleted.

When you modify or publish a message, an additional cookie is stored by your browser. This cookie does not contain any personal data and only contains the post ID of the article you have edited. This cookie expires after one day.

Embedded content from other sites

Messages on this site may contain embedded content (e.g. videos, images, messages, etc.). Embedded content from other sites behaves exactly the same as if the visitor has visited this other site.

These sites may collect information about you, use cookies, embed additional third-party tracking, and monitor your interaction with this embedded content, including recording interaction with embedded content if you have an account and are logged into that site.
